Transaction e64cc886435890f6b28eef73da7cd231cecf57de138cf68bc0c25a0ea8edb44d
1 Input
-
cf100d819150ddc0dc2a205efe5349269995c9af4572315c22b023a249e8b6df:0
OP_DATA_48(48) 44022073d6e944a1630c976692bf4c43095d9c81d593a252dbe68503488c8a844171cd0220531a95e2e747dbd7e1a3b4
1 Outputs
- e64cc886435890f6b28eef73da7cd231cecf57de138cf68bc0c25a0ea8edb44d:0
value 537494
address 3BmA9Pa4WjugmLR1UX58cTpC6vRyLGjBCK